Wikipedia description:

Mitchell A. Seligson (died June 1, 2024) was the Centennial Professor of Political Science and Professor of Sociology at Vanderbilt University. He founded and was Senior Advisor to the Latin American Public Opinion Project (LAPOP), which conducts the AmericasBarometer surveys that currently cover 27 countries in the Americas. Seligson has published many books and papers on political science topics. He was elected to membership in the General Assembly of the Inter-American Institute of Human Rights in 2011.
